The name of this 6th Avenue eatery means "our house" in the West Indian island of Guadeloupe's Creole language. The menu is a mixture of French and French-Caribbean, with dishes such as an escargot appetizer, smoked jerk chicken in honey sauce and a West Indian burger with avocado salsa and cheese. Candlelit tables and pillow-covered seats create an intimate, subdued atmosphere, accompanied by live music on Sundays and Tuesdays. Liquor is BYOB.
